Liberty High is a large high school in Bealeton, Virginia, enrolling 1,313 students.
Class sizes run a bit leaner than typical: 12.9:1 puts it in the smaller third of Virginia schools by student-teacher ratio.
Economic need runs somewhat below the state's typical profile, with 38.2% of students eligible for free meals.
By headcount it is one of the larger campuses in Virginia, bigger than 91% of state schools at 1,313 students.
Its Resource Investment Index sits near the middle of the pack among 1,868 scored Virginia schools.
Against 140 statewide peers matched on enrollment and economic need, it ranks mid-pack at #60.
Its student body is led by White (49%) and Hispanic or Latino (34%) (diversity index 63/100).
On the academic-pipeline side it reports 24 Advanced Placement courses.
Counselor coverage runs a bit thin, about 263 students per counselor, somewhat past the ASCA-recommended 250:1 benchmark.
Attendance runs somewhat below the norm, with 24.4% of students chronically absent per the 2021-22 civil-rights collection.
Discipline events run high: 272 in- and out-of-school suspensions were reported for 1,313 students in the 2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ection.
Fauquier County Public Schools also operates Kettle Run High (1,175 students) and Fauquier High (1,156 students) alongside Liberty High.
